Over 3.1m tonnes of cargo transported via Angren Logistic Center
Tashkent, Uzbekistan (UzDaily.com) -- About 3.1 million tonnes of freight were transported through newly created Angren Logistic Center (Angren Logistic Center CJSC, Tashkent region of Uzbekistan) in nine months of 2010, a publication of the Ministry of Economy and the State Statistics Committee of Uzbekistan.

International Logistics Center has been commissioned in Angren, Tashkent region of Uzbekistan. The center was created on the base of Ablyk railway station.

The center was created to accept and process freights and their transportation to Andijan, Namangan and Ferghana region with help of motor transport.

The Government of Uzbekistan adopted decision to stop railway transportation of cargo to these three regions from other parts of Uzbekistan via Tajikistan, which should promote to develop the center.

It is expected that the center will transport 4.2 million tonnes of cargo in 2010, including spare parts for vehicles and ready products of GM Uzbekistan, oil products of Ferghana refinery and others.
